Transaction 34e67d6591d55e35fa6c89890d549d9a32fb04b1c7768cd54fb197a7529e9aaa
1 Input
2 Outputs
- 34e67d6591d55e35fa6c89890d549d9a32fb04b1c7768cd54fb197a7529e9aaa:0
- 34e67d6591d55e35fa6c89890d549d9a32fb04b1c7768cd54fb197a7529e9aaa:1
value 102629585
address 3P3Hc12A4tCMu7G28nNTeiNPTmgbaDpbHm
value 21340000
address 15XZeXqM1kcuuuAVAvVVwRPC1LT15uYrqH